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ative efforts all belong to the protection scope of the present invention.
The utility model provides a vertical sealing machine for big bags, which is convenient to adjust and has high adjustment stability, please refer to fig. 1-3, comprising a supporting mechanism 100, a conveying mechanism 200, an adjusting screw 300, a limiting slide bar 400 and a control panel 500;
referring to fig. 2, the supporting mechanism 100 is used for supporting the mounting and conveying mechanism 200, the adjusting screw 300, the limiting slide bar 400 and the control panel 500;
referring to fig. 3, the conveying mechanism 200 is located at the front side of the supporting mechanism 100, specifically, the conveying mechanism 200 is fixedly connected to the front side of the top of the bottom plate 110 by bolts, and the conveying mechanism 200 is sealed by conveying the pockets;
referring to fig. 1-3 again, the adjusting screw 300 is screwed inside the supporting mechanism 100, and the adjusting screw 300 is used for adjusting the height of the sealing machine 420;
referring to fig. 1-3 again, the limiting slide bars 400 are located at the left and right sides inside the supporting mechanism 100, the outer side walls of the limiting slide bars 400 are slidably connected with moving sliders 410, a sealing machine 420 is fixedly connected between the front side walls of the moving sliders 410, a stud 430 is fixedly connected to the middle of the rear side wall of the sealing machine 420 through a bolt, the stud 430 is screwed on the outer side wall of the adjusting screw 300, specifically, the limiting slide bars 400 are fixedly connected between the bottom plate 110 and the left and right sides of the inner side wall of the connecting rod 130 through bolts, the limiting slide bars 400 are used for supporting the sealing machine 420 to lift, the moving sliders 410 are used for installing the sealing machine 420, and the studs 430 are used for connecting the sealing machine 420 and the adjusting screw 300;
referring to fig. 1, the control panel 500 is electrically connected to the conveying mechanism 200 through an electric wire, the control panel 500 is embedded at the right side of the front sidewall of the sealing machine 420, and the control panel 500 is used for controlling the start and stop of the conveying mechanism 200 and the sealing machine 420.
Referring to fig. 1 to 3 again, in order to improve the operation stability of the sealing machine 420, the supporting mechanism 100 includes a base plate 110, a vertical column 120 and a connecting rod 130, the vertical column 120 is fixedly connected to the rear sides of the left and right sides of the top of the base plate 110 by a bolt, and the connecting rod 130 is fixedly connected between the top ends of the vertical columns 120 by a bolt.
Referring to fig. 1-3 again, in order to facilitate the moving operation of the sealing machine 420, the four corners of the bottom plate 110 are fixedly connected with universal wheels 111 through bolts, and the outer side walls of the universal wheels 111 are provided with wavy anti-slip threads.
Referring to fig. 1 and 3, in order to improve the sealing efficiency of the sealing machine 420, the conveying mechanism 200 includes a conveying frame 210, a rotating shaft 220 and a conveying belt 230, the rotating shaft 220 is rotatably connected between the left and right sides of the front and rear side walls of the inner cavity of the conveying frame 210, the conveying belt 230 is rotatably connected between the outer side walls of the rotating shaft 220, the left side of the rear side wall of the conveying frame 210 is fixedly connected with a servo motor 211 through a bolt, and the front end of a power output shaft of the servo motor 211 is fixedly connected to the rear end of the rotating shaft 220 on the left side.
Referring to fig. 1-3 again, in order to facilitate the adjustment of the elevation of the sealing machine 420 during practical use, the adjusting screw 300 is rotatably connected between the bottom plate 110 and the inner sidewall of the connecting rod 130, the top end of the adjusting screw 300 penetrates through the connecting rod 130 and extends to the top end of the connecting rod 130, and the rotating disc 310 is fixedly connected thereto.
Referring to fig. 1 to 3 again, in order to enable the sealing machine 420 to be always aligned when adjusting, the lower side of the outer side wall of the limiting slide rod 400 is fixedly connected with a fixing block 440 through a bolt, the front side wall of the fixing block 440 is fixedly connected with a support rod 441, and a limiting plate 442 is fixedly connected between the front ends of the support rods 441.
When the bag sealing machine is used specifically, when a large bag is sealed by a person in the technical field, the sealing machine is pushed to a designated sealing place through the universal wheels 111, the sealing machine is connected with a power supply, the sealing machine 420 runs and is preheated, products are placed into the bag, the height of the bag filled with the products is adjusted according to the height of the bag, the rotary table 310 is rotated, the rotary table 310 drives the adjusting screw 300 to rotate, the adjusting screw 300 drives the stud 430 to move, the sealing machine 420 moves up and down on the outer side of the limiting slide rod 400 under the action of the movable sliding block 410 to adjust, after the adjustment is completed, the bag can be sealed, the bag is placed on the conveying belt 230, the servo motor 211 drives the rotary shaft 220 to rotate, the rotary shaft 220 drives the conveying belt 230 to rotate, the bag is conveyed, the bag is sealed through the sealing machine 420, meanwhile, in the bag moving process, the limiting plate 442 limits the position of the conveying bag, and prevents the bag from being cut obliquely or toppled over in the conveying process of sealing.
